物联网智能边缘计算平台——智能计算就在身边
摘要
物联网智能边缘计算平台通过将计算能力下沉至设备边缘,解决了传统云计算在延迟、带宽和隐私方面的痛点。本文从技术架构、应用场景、开发实践三个维度展开,结合工业质检、智慧医疗、车路协同等案例,解析其如何实现“智能计算就在身边”,并探讨开发者如何快速构建边缘智能应用。
一、从云端到边缘:智能计算的范式变革
1.1 传统云计算的局限性
在物联网场景中,设备产生的数据量呈指数级增长。以智能制造为例,一条生产线每秒可产生数GB的传感器数据(如温度、振动、图像)。若将所有数据上传至云端处理,会面临三大挑战:
- 高延迟:云端往返时间(RTT)可能超过100ms,无法满足实时控制需求(如机械臂协同)。
- 带宽瓶颈:单台设备每日产生1TB数据时,千兆网络也难以支撑。
- 隐私风险:医疗、金融等敏感数据需在本地处理,避免泄露。
1.2 边缘计算的崛起
边缘计算通过在数据源附近部署计算节点,实现“数据不出域、计算在身边”。其核心价值在于:
- 实时性:将AI推理延迟从秒级降至毫秒级(如自动驾驶障碍物检测)。
- 带宽优化:仅上传关键数据(如异常事件),减少90%以上流量。
- 可靠性:断网环境下仍可维持基础功能(如工厂设备本地控制)。
二、物联网智能边缘计算平台的技术架构
2.1 分层架构设计
典型的边缘计算平台包含三层:
- 设备层:传感器、摄像头、执行器等终端设备,支持MQTT/CoAP等轻量级协议。
- 边缘层:部署在工厂、基站或车辆中的边缘服务器,运行轻量化AI模型(如TensorFlow Lite)。
- 云端层:提供模型训练、设备管理和全局调度功能。
2.2 关键技术组件
- 边缘AI框架:支持模型压缩、量化(如INT8)和动态调度,例如:
# 示例:使用TensorFlow Lite在边缘设备上运行模型interpreter = tf.lite.Interpreter(model_path="edge_model.tflite")interpreter.allocate_tensors()input_data = np.array([...], dtype=np.float32)interpreter.set_tensor(input_details[0]['index'], input_data)interpreter.invoke()output_data = interpreter.get_tensor(output_details[0]['index'])
- 数据预处理:在边缘完成数据清洗、特征提取,减少无效数据上传。
- 安全机制:包括设备认证(如X.509证书)、数据加密(TLS 1.3)和访问控制。
三、典型应用场景解析
3.1 工业质检:实时缺陷检测
某汽车零部件厂商部署边缘计算平台后,实现:
- 本地化处理:在产线旁部署GPU边缘服务器,运行YOLOv5目标检测模型。
- 效果对比:
| 指标 | 云端方案 | 边缘方案 |
|———————|—————|—————|
| 检测延迟 | 800ms | 120ms |
| 带宽占用 | 100% | 15% |
| 误检率 | 2.3% | 0.8% |
3.2 智慧医疗:床边监护
可穿戴设备通过边缘计算实现:
- 实时预警:本地ECG分析,发现心律失常立即触发警报。
- 隐私保护:患者数据仅在病房边缘服务器处理,需授权方可上传至云端。
3.3 车路协同:低延迟路况感知
智能交通系统中,路侧单元(RSU)通过边缘计算:
- 多源融合:整合摄像头、雷达数据,生成300ms更新频率的局部地图。
- 协同决策:与车载单元(OBU)交互,实现交叉路口优先通行控制。
四、开发者实践指南
4.1 快速入门步骤
- 选择硬件平台:根据算力需求选择NVIDIA Jetson、华为Atlas或瑞芯微RK3588等边缘设备。
- 模型优化:使用TensorFlow Model Optimization Toolkit进行量化:
converter = tf.lite.TFLiteConverter.from_saved_model(saved_model_dir)converter.optimizations = [tf.lite.Optimize.DEFAULT]quantized_model = converter.convert()
- 部署测试:通过Kubernetes Edge或K3s管理边缘节点,验证模型在真实场景中的表现。
4.2 性能调优技巧
- 动态批处理:根据输入数据量调整批次大小,平衡延迟与吞吐量。
- 模型选择:优先使用MobileNetV3、EfficientNet-Lite等轻量级架构。
- 硬件加速:利用GPU/NPU指令集优化(如ARM NEON)。
五、未来趋势与挑战
5.1 技术演进方向
- AI原生边缘:模型架构与边缘硬件深度协同(如神经处理单元NPU)。
- 联邦学习:在边缘节点间分布式训练模型,避免数据集中。
- 数字孪生:边缘计算支撑物理设备的实时数字镜像。
5.2 落地挑战应对
- 异构设备管理:通过统一边缘操作系统(如EdgeX Foundry)兼容不同厂商设备。
- 安全防护:采用零信任架构,持续验证设备身份与行为。
- 成本优化:探索按需付费的边缘资源调度模式。
结语
物联网智能边缘计算平台正在重塑智能计算的边界。通过将AI能力延伸至数据产生地,它不仅解决了实时性、带宽和隐私的核心问题,更创造了“智能计算就在身边”的新体验。对于开发者而言,掌握边缘计算技术意味着抓住下一代物联网应用的关键入口;对于企业用户,部署边缘平台则是提升竞争力、实现数字化转型的必由之路。未来,随着5G+AIoT的深度融合,边缘智能必将渗透至更多场景,让智能真正无处不在。